The Bitfinex hack, which occurred in August 2016, was one of the largest thefts in the history of cryptocurrency exchanges. Hackers exploited vulnerabilities in the exchange’s security protocols, leading to the unauthorized withdrawal of a significant amount of Bitcoin. At the time, the stolen Bitcoin was valued at around $72 million, but as the cryptocurrency market has evolved, the value of the stolen assets has skyrocketed, making the recovery of these funds even more critical. The U.S. government’s recent order to return the seized Bitcoin underscores the importance of addressing such high-profile cases in a manner that reflects the changing landscape of digital assets.
In the years following the hack, law enforcement agencies, including the Department of Justice (DOJ), have been actively investigating the incident. Their efforts culminated in the seizure of a portion of the stolen Bitcoin, which was traced to various wallets linked to the hackers. This tracing process involved sophisticated blockchain analysis techniques, highlighting the transparency and traceability inherent in cryptocurrency transactions. As a result, the authorities were able to identify and recover a significant amount of the stolen assets, demonstrating the potential for law enforcement to combat cybercrime in the digital age.

In light of such high-profile breaches, cryptocurrency exchanges are increasingly recognizing the necessity of investing in sophisticated cybersecurity technologies. These measures include multi-signature wallets, cold storage solutions, and advanced encryption techniques, all aimed at safeguarding user funds from malicious actors. Furthermore, exchanges are beginning to adopt a proactive approach to security by conducting regular audits and penetration testing to identify and rectify potential weaknesses in their systems.
